Pagination in the Lattivo Plugin API uses opaque cursors. Every list endpoint returns a `next_cursor` field; pass it back as the `cursor` query parameter to fetch the next page. Page size defaults to 50, max 200 via `limit`. Cursors expire after 15 minutes — do not cache them. Empty `next_cursor` means you've reached the end. Plugin authors testing against the Lattivo sandbox must route calls through the internal gateway, which requires its own credential. For sandbox testing, use the key below.

gateway credential: kto3_qfe

MEMO: FY Headcount Plan

For the incoming director. Next year's plan: net growth of eleven roles. Engineering gets six, field ops three, support two. Backfills require VP sign-off. Hiring freezes apply to the Dunmore office until lease matters settle. Budget assumes mid-year start dates. Recruiting kicks off after board approval. The strategic context is captured in the confidential note below.

internal memo for yahag-hahig: Belwynix Group plans to lower the Silir list price by 62 percent in May.

Quick note for support: the Barrowline CI stale-cache bug is fixed, but customers on older agents may still see phantom green builds for a day or so. Tell them to clear the workspace cache once and rerun — no reinstall needed. The postmortem doc has full details. The patched agent build is identified right below this note.

build token for kagaf-hahof: htk14_9d3d4d26d7d8de

Runbook: Quillpress markdown rendering pipeline

Plugin authors: your transform runs after sanitization but before syntax highlighting. If your plugin emits raw HTML, it will be stripped; use the node API instead. Rendering timeouts are 400ms per document — exceed that and your plugin is skipped with a warning in the build log. The supported node types and hook order are documented on the page below.

dashboard of bafof-hafog = https://confluence.lumiclabs.internal/display/browse/display/6a09a20a